How much do robotic process automation remote jobs pay per year?

As of Aug 22, 2026, the average yearly pay for robotic process automation remote in Northbrook, IL is $109,535.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$85,800.00 and $132,500.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

Role Overview
As a consultant, you will independently lead initiatives, providing technical direction during design sessions with clients and Ashling project leads. Your responsibilities will include designing and building cloud solutions leveraging the latest AI and ML capabilities available from major cloud offering providers for clients. You will collaborate with engineers to efficiently implement algorithms within existing production processes and assist in establishing design and coding standards, policies, and procedures across development efforts. Additionally, you will provide recommendations on improving team efficiency from a code reusability standpoint.
What You Will Do:
  • Participate in design sessions with clients and Ashling project leads to provide technical direction on design considerations for development, performance, scalability, availability, maintainability, and reusability.
  • Leverage numerical methods and testing algorithms for evaluating LLM performance for different use cases.
  • Collaborate with engineers to implement algorithms efficiently with existing production processes
  • Assist with design and coding standards, testing pipelines, policies and procedures across development efforts.

What You Will Bring:
  • Bachelor's degree in computer science or engineering discipline
  • 2+ years of programming experience
  • 2+ years of .NET development experience (C#)
  • Experience in one of the major cloud providers such as Azure, GCP or AWS
  • Proven experience implementing LLM capabilities into cloud solutions
  • Experience with Azure DevOps Pipelines
  • Interested in intelligent automation market and cloud infrastructure technologies
  • Experience in statistics or numerical methods is a plus but not required
  • Experience in Power Platform is a plus but not required
  • Experience with prompt engineering and LLM evaluation frameworks (e.g., Azure AI Foundry evaluation, Ragas) is a plus but not required
  • Experience building RAG pipelines using Azure AI Search or vector databases is a plus but not required
  • Familiarity with agent interoperability protocols (MCP, Agent2Agent/A2A) is a plus but not required
  • Experience with Azure AI Document Intelligence or other OCR/intelligent document processing tools is a plus but not required
